Louisiana Republican Governor Bobby Jindal addresses the NRA annual Convention May 3, 2013 in Houston, Texas. More than 70,000 members of the nation's premier gun rights organization have flocked to Texas for the three-day gathering, hard on the heels of the defeat of new federal gun laws in the US Senate.

Jindal appoints Babb
Bobby Jindal recently announced appointments to the Louisiana Racing Commission, including Keith Babb of Monroe. The Louisiana Racing Commission serves to enforce rules and regulations, propose legislation, and develop policies for the Louisiana racing industry. from Ouachita Citizen Read more »
